Transaction 874ae20879fdc4960463415581fbf4a4e4c8a8e3c77cca02e451df132110bcfe

1 Input
2 Outputs
  • 874ae20879fdc4960463415581fbf4a4e4c8a8e3c77cca02e451df132110bcfe:0
  • value  25080000
    address  1DXj5JwdYjLupHcUzV71gABXGnTogT7jbp
  • 874ae20879fdc4960463415581fbf4a4e4c8a8e3c77cca02e451df132110bcfe:1
  • value  10892880
    address  1LejyicCJaojVgHLbH8NN6eUv61kWHzK9n